Responsibilities
- Interpret blueprints, schematics, and technical drawings to accurately assemble and install structural steel components.
- Use specialized tools such as ohmmeters and construction management software like ProCore, Bluebeam, Primavera P6, and HeavyBid to plan, track, and execute tasks efficiently.
- Safely operate heavy machinery and equipment required for lifting, positioning, and securing steel structures on-site.
- Collaborate with project managers and supervisors to coordinate schedules, monitor progress, and ensure adherence to safety standards including OSHA regulations.
- Supervise and mentor junior team members, ensuring quality control and adherence to project specifications.
- Conduct routine inspections of work sites for safety hazards or structural issues; implement corrective actions as needed.
- Assist in project estimating, budgeting, and managing contracts to meet project deadlines within scope.
